Efficient End to End Verifiable Electronic Voting Employing Split Value Representations
نویسندگان
چکیده
We present a simple and fast method for conducting end to end voting and allowing public verification of correctness of the announced vote tallying results. In the present note voter privacy protection is achieved by use of a simple form of distributing the tallying of votes and creation of a verifiable proof of correctness amongst several servers, combined with random representations of integers as sums mod M of two values. At the end of vote tallying process, random permutations of the cast votes are publicly posted in the clear, without identification of voters or ballot ids. Thus vote counting and assurance of correct form of cast votes are directly available. Also, a proof of the claim that the revealed votes are a permutation of the concealed cast votes is publicly posted and verifiable by any interested party. We present two versions of the method, one assuring voter privacy and proof of correctness in the presence of information leaking devices, the other achieving the same goals as well as prevention of denial of service by failing or sabotaged devices. Advantages of this method are: Easy understandability by noncryptographers, implementers, and ease of use by voters and election officials. Direct handling of complicated ballot forms. Independence from any specialized cryptographic primitives. Verifiable mix nets without using public-key or homomorphic cryptography, a novel result of significance beyond e-voting. Speed of vote-tallying and correctness proving: elections involving a million voters can be tallied and proof of correctness of results posted within a few minutes.
منابع مشابه
The Implementation of a Split - Value Verifiable Voting System
This study provides a proof-of-concept of a newly designed verifiable voting system. The implementation elicits details in the communication and synchronization among servers, unavailable in the original design paper [M. O. Rabin and R. L. Rivest, "Efficient End to End Verifiable Electronic Voting Employing Split Value Representations." in Proc. EVOTE ’14, Bregenz, Austria.]. The implemented sy...
متن کاملPractical End-to-End Verifiable Voting via Split-Value Representations and Randomized Partial Checking
We describe how to use Rabin’s “split-value” representations, originally developed for use in secure auctions, to efficiently implement end-to-end verifiable voting. We propose a simple and very elegant combination of split-value representations with “randomized partial checking” (due to Jakobsson et al. [16]).
متن کاملEnd-to-end veriable voting with Prêt à Voter
Transparent and verifiable elections can be achieved by end-to-end verifiable electronic voting systems. The purpose of such systems is to enable voters to verify the inclusion of their vote in the final tally while keeping the votes secret. Achieving verifiability and secrecy at the same time is hard and this thesis explores the properties of verifiable electronic voting systems and describes ...
متن کاملA vVote: a Verifiable Voting System
This paper details a design for end-to-end verifiable voting in the Australian state of Victoria, based on the Prêt à Voter end-to-end verifiable voting system [Ryan et al. 2009]. The system ran successfully in the state election in Victoria (Australia) in November 2014, taking a total of 1121 votes from supervised polling places inside Victoria and overseas. The proposed protocol is end-to-end...
متن کاملSecure and Verifiable Electronic Voting in Practice: the use of vVote in the Victorian State Election
The November 2014 Australian State of Victoria election was the first statutory political election worldwide at State level which deployed an end-to-end verifiable electronic voting system in polling places. This was the first time blind voters have been able to cast a fully secret ballot in a verifiable way, and the first time a verifiable voting system has been used to collect remote votes in...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2014